The George Akume Campaign Organisation says it is almost certain that Sen.George Akume, the Minister of Special Duties, will emerge as the National Chairman of the All Progressives Congress (APC) at the March 26 Convention of the party.

Chief Ray Morphy, the Co-ordinator South of the organisation said this in a statement on Monday in Abuja.
Morphy said that the zoning of the position to the North-Central by the party was a big advantage to Akume, who hailed from the zone.
He said that some members of the APC National Executive Committee (NEC) have also declared their support for Akume.
“Some of these include Mr. Sadiq Fakai from North-West, Zonal Youth Leader, Mr. Adamu Abubakar from North-East and Mr. Terver Aginde from North-Central.
“The support coming from some NEC members and supporters of two other major contenders who have been zoned out of the race, however, soared the minister’s chances of emerging as the next APC national chairman,” he said.
He said the supporters' groups included the Senator Ali Modu Sheriff Nationalist Movement and Malam Isa Yuguda Support Organisation.

Murphy said the groups at the end of their meeting unanimously agreed to join forces with Coalition of North-East APC Groups to mobilise support for Akume to ensure his emergence as APC national chairman.
This he said was because the party had zoned the position to the North Central.
“The communique by the groups at the end of the meeting was signed by Malam Ayuba Hassan, Convener, Coalition of North-East APC Groups and Alhaji Yusuf Grema, Coordinator, Ali Modu Sherrif Nationalist Movement,” he said.He said Hajiya Murja Musa, Women Leader, Yuguda Support Organisations also signed the communique.

According to him, the group plans to hold a mega solidarity rally for Akume for APC national chairman in Maiduguri and Abuja on Wednesday, March 16. He said the groups would consequently move to the National Assembly to appeal to the National Assembly APC caucus to endorse Akume’s candidacy.
